Biden: No Sign Attack on Britain’s Tehran Embassy Was Orchestrated by Iranian Govt
by Jason Ditz,
December 01, 2011
Speaking in an interview with Reuters today, Vice President Joe Biden said that there was no indication whatsoever that the Iranian government in any way orchestrated the attack on Britain’s embassy in Tehran. Britain responded to the attack by expelling Iran’s ambassador from the country and Foreign Secretary William Hague accused the government of “backing” the attack.
